1. Adjective is a word that describes a noun. An adjective is a word that gives more information about the noun. Example : a. The sky is blue b. I like blue skies c. He is a nice man 2. Adverb is a word that modifies a verb, adjective, determiner, clause, preposition, or sentence. Typically express manner, place, time, frequency, degree, level of certainty, etc. Example : a. She sang loudly b. We left it here c. I worked yesterday 3. Interjection is word for express meaning or feeling in a word or two. Instead, interjection simply convey what the speaker feeling. Example : a. Bless you! I couldn’t have done it without you b. Grrr. I’m going to get back at him for that c. Oopss, I forgot something
